Site work and new construction of a water / sewer project in Glen Easton, West Virginia. Completed plans call for site work for a one-story above grade water / sewer project.
**As of February 13, 2025 this project has not yet been awarded. A timeline for award has not yet been established.** Construct a new 122,000-gallon water storage tank as part of the Water System Improvements Project, Contract #2 - 122,000 Gallon Bowman Ridge Tank Replacement. The contract period is 240 calendar days for substantial completion and 270 calendar days for final payment from the time the contract times commence. Liquidated damages are set at $1,000 per day. Bidders must comply with a two-envelope system for bid submission. Envelope No. 1 must include the bidder's name and address, the contract being bid upon, and be clearly marked as received by the Marshall County Public Service District #4. Envelope No. 2, labeled "Bid Proposal," must be enclosed within Envelope No. 1. Envelope No. 1 will be checked for required documents per the Bid Opening Checklist. If compliance is confirmed, Envelope No. 2 will then be opened and read aloud. Non-compliance will result in exclusion from consideration. Key instructions include: - Full compliance with Disadvantaged Business Enterprises and Affirmative Action Requirements, including making positive efforts to subcontract with disadvantaged businesses, following outlined affirmative steps. - Bids may not be withdrawn for 90 days after the bid opening date. - All bids must be accompanied by a certified check or bid bond equal to 5% of the base bid. - Contractors must not be listed on the federal "System for Award Management" (SAM) for suspension or debarment. - Compliance with federal wage laws (Davis Bacon Act), "Build America, Buy America" requirements, and all relevant state regulations, including the West Virginia Drug Free Workplace Act and licensing requirements. - Submission of a signed drug-free workplace affidavit with the bid documents is mandatory, and failure to do so will result in disqualification. - Only bidders attending the mandatory pre-bid conference are eligible to submit bids. - The Marshall County Public Service District #4 reserves the right to reject any and all bids. For additional requirements regarding bid submittal, qualifications, procedures, and contract award, refer to the Instructions to Bidders included in the Bidding Documents.
